Output 6fb631db88ae74d87d23d04860dc9e2913441853a0283dd49e15b1d4b9d1b279:1

value
3487495951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0afe98d4393132e1f233acb1125c0465381b8f6 OP_EQUAL
address
3HoFaubSSwQrcqjBFuBN6DmZfKfaBGcJiK
transaction
6fb631db88ae74d87d23d04860dc9e2913441853a0283dd49e15b1d4b9d1b279
spent
true